‘All we want is our money’ — Nsimbi miners after holding SA managers hostage in Mozambique

Daily Maverick

Police secure release of three Nsimbi Mining managers in Mozambique after being held hostage by unpaid workers demanding wages. Managers Japie du Toit, Shedrick Festus, and Mary Chuva were confined since April 29. Workers demanded payments before releasing them. Managers confirmed release and payment agreement. Du Toit unsure of return to South Africa.
